Warning Signs of a Pigeon Problem in Orland Park
- Accumulation of droppings on ledges, windowsills, rooftops, or walkways
- Persistent cooing sounds, especially in early morning and evening hours
- Blocked gutters and drainage systems from nesting debris
- Increased insect activity (mites, ticks, beetles) associated with pigeon nests
- Visible damage to rooftop equipment, solar panels, or signage
- Slip hazards on walkways and loading docks from accumulated droppings
- Feathers and debris collecting near air intake vents or HVAC systems
- Eggshell fragments or juvenile birds visible on rooftops or in building cavities
- White streaking below rooflines or window ledges indicating active roosts above
- Groups of pigeons repeatedly returning to the same rooftop or ledge at dusk
DIY vs. Professional Pigeon Control in Orland Park
| DIY Method | Effectiveness | Limitation |
|---|---|---|
| Visual deterrents (fake owls, reflective tape) | Temporarily effective for 1-2 weeks | Pigeons quickly habituate and ignore them |
| Removing food sources | Helpful as part of a broader plan | Urban environments provide too many alternative food sources for this alone |
| Sealing individual entry points | Effective for specific openings | Pigeons find alternative entry points without comprehensive exclusion |
| Water sprinklers or motion sprays | Some short-term deterrence | Not practical for rooftops or upper ledges; water waste and maintenance cost |
| Homemade spice or vinegar sprays | Very short-term deterrent | Washes away with rain and requires constant reapplication |

Health Risks from Pigeon Infestations in Orland Park
Pigeon droppings and nests harbor pathogens that pose real health risks. Professional cleanup is strongly recommended.
Histoplasmosis
Cause: Inhalation of Histoplasma capsulatum spores found in dried pigeon droppings
Symptoms: Fever, chest pain, cough; can become severe in immunocompromised individuals
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ention
Aspergillosis
Cause: Inhalation of Aspergillus fumigatus spores that thrive in accumulated droppings and nesting debris
Symptoms: Allergic reactions, chronic cough, wheezing; invasive lung infection in immunocompromised patients
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ention
Psittacosis
Cause: Inhalation of Chlamydia psittaci bacteria from dried droppings or feather dust
Symptoms: Pneumonia-like illness with fever, headache, and dry cough
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ention
Ectoparasite infestations
Cause: Pigeon mites, ticks, and bird bugs that can migrate into living spaces from nearby nests
Symptoms: Skin irritation, bites; potential secondary infections
Source: University extension entomology departments
Salmonellosis
Cause: Contact with surfaces contaminated by pigeon droppings
Symptoms: Gastrointestinal illness including n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ea
Source: WHO — World Health Organization
